Basket of Apples Craft

You Will Need:
● At least 2 apples cut in half, one lengthwise, one widthwise
● A recycled brown paper shopping bag
● Scissors and glue
● Washable tempera paints in red, green and/or yellow
● A black marker for writing a holiday greeting if you wish
● White construction paper
Trace and cut the shape of a basket onto your recycled brown paper bag. It’s OK if the bag has
writing and graphics on it, I actually think it makes it look even better! Glue the basket base to
the bottom portion of your white paper. Cut the handles off of your recycled bag to use as a
basket handle. Glue to the base of the basket as shown in the above photo. Once dry, you’ll get
to dip right into apple printing a basket full of apples! Some children might enjoy getting their
hands in and on this activity and that just adds to the charm. I find it helpful to keep a wet
washcloth or wipes alongside our art station for quick preliminary cleanup before that painty
handed march to the bathroom sink. Having children squeeze their painty hands together as
they walk is a great way to eliminate wandering fingerprints around your home. The finished
project is a lovely decoration for your home or can be given as a holiday greeting to friends and
family.
